Overview

The NRSWA Unit O1 course equips participants with the essential knowledge and skills to carry out safe and compliant excavation work in the road or highway. Delivered in line with the Street Works Qualification Regulations (SWQR), this course ensures that excavation activities are performed safely, efficiently, and without damage to underground utilities or surrounding infrastructure.

Training is delivered through a combination of classroom theory and supervised practical sessions, where participants gain hands-on experience in setting out, excavating, and maintaining safe working areas. On successful completion, delegates will receive certification and registration with the Street Works Qualification Register (SWQR).

Objectives

By the end of the course, participants will be able to:

  • Understand the requirements of the New Roads and Street Works Act (NRSWA).
  • Prepare and maintain a safe excavation site in line with industry standards.
  • Interpret utility drawings and identify underground apparatus.
  • Excavate holes and trenches safely using appropriate tools and equipment.
  • Apply safe systems of work to protect workers, utilities, and the public.
  • Backfill and prepare the excavation for reinstatement in compliance with specification.

Pre-Course Requirements

No formal qualifications are required, but a basic level of written and spoken English is necessary. PPE is required, including safety boots, hi-visibility clothing, gloves, safety glasses, and a safety helmet.

Who Should Attend?

This course is ideal for operatives involved in excavation works on roads and highways, including those working in utilities, civil engineering, groundworks, and construction.
